自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(9)
  • 收藏
  • 关注

原创 刷题日记day9 (2025/11/22)

/最开始感染蚂蚁不管左右,右边的蚂蚁往左走,左边的蚂蚁往右走都会被感染。//而那些在感染蚂蚁相撞之前就相撞,其实可以无视(视为直接路过)把所有相遇的蚂蚁都看作路过,而不是交换方向。//因为总会与其他被感染的蚂蚁相撞。

2025-11-22 22:51:38 207

原创 刷题日记day8 (2025/11/21)

直接裴蜀定理ab-a-b(找两个互质的数的最大的不能组成的数)//两个数的最大公因数,公约数的倍数能得到所有这两个数的组合数//大于1就总有数不能被组成,所以不存在最大//2 6//2 无法组成奇数//裴蜀定理//给定两个互质的正整数 a 和 b最大的不能表示为 ax+by(其中 x,y 为非负整数)的整数是 ab−a−b。如果不知道定理:1.仔细分析,找到 两个数的最大公因数,公约数的倍数能得到所有这两个数的组合数。

2025-11-21 15:36:22 308

原创 刷题日记day7 (2025/11/20)

开数组,把每个坐标的的价值输入,然后计算后缀和,然后在进行枚举memory是内存过大//只能开一个数组 5000*5000*2=500M>5000 × 5000 × 4字节 = 100,000,000字节 ≈ 95.37MB。

2025-11-21 00:24:43 343

原创 刷题日记day6 (2025/11/19)

常规二分,主要要理解该巧克力边长,要(h[i]/n)*(w[i]/n)>k。

2025-11-19 09:20:13 209

原创 刷题日记day5 (2025/11/12)

理解过程中E的变化不管E是否大于h,始终E1=2E0-h(0)然后把这个作为二分判断是否通过的遍历依据,查找出目标值*E<0说明不是这个值可以直接return*E>1e5,前面一次超过1e5后面每一次都会超过因为2E-h的最大值依旧大于1e5,这样可以节省运行次数。

2025-11-12 23:38:24 198

原创 刷题日记day4 (2025/11/6)

就是常规的二分,但是目标数可以重复,要求写出目标数,首次出现和最后的位置.因此要在基础的二分之上,进行两次二分,前一次寻找首次出现的位置if(没找到)cout<<-1<<" "<<-1<<endl;else {第二次寻找*** 当l=mid时要mid=l+r+1>>1;避免死循环。

2025-11-06 22:43:17 104

原创 刷题日记day3 (2025/11/5)

没啥思路,就是哪里不对反哪里就行,因为题目一定有解。

2025-11-05 14:23:18 195

原创 刷题日记day2 (2025/11/4)

第一次相对自主写出来的一道算法题!!!!!!!!!!!想哭555555555555555555铭记此刻......

2025-11-04 23:03:49 262

原创 刷题日记day1 (2025/11/3)

二进制枚举:处理小规模组合问题递推思想:利用问题结构减少搜索空间位运算:高效的状态操作。

2025-11-04 00:21:10 747 1

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除